Transaction 152aac67fad112ce371c0e5a59b49514d888b82162d76759aad543120cd1800d
1 Input
1 Output
-
152aac67fad112ce371c0e5a59b49514d888b82162d76759aad543120cd1800d: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 55496686cc8ddd080892aae3ff67221ea0d18a69803830ca751fafdf40dd0232
- address
- bc1p24ykdpkv3hwsszyj4t3l7eezr6sdrznfsqurpjn4r7ha7sxaqgeqtqy8df